Output e587390808360ba6eb0640302003647fb1f0c5e3a9ef67f7f0bc678f52f12ff2:0

value
17000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34132f3c9ba5074ed3c3494fd778a99e56f6856c OP_EQUALVERIFY OP_CHECKSIG
address
15kM7wTTYRbGQJQx3VCdpB5oithTxVqZAE
transaction
e587390808360ba6eb0640302003647fb1f0c5e3a9ef67f7f0bc678f52f12ff2
spent
true